    Suspect arrested on steroids charges

    By PAUL SHUKOVSKY
    SEATTLE POST-INTELLIGENCER REPORTER

    Federal agents and Snohomish County Regional Drug Task Force investigators arrested a Marysville man yesterday morning on charges that he trafficked in anabolic steroids, used by athletes to build muscle mass.

    Franklin C. Witter, 45, allegedly distributed steroids such as testosterone as well as narcotic pain medications such as oxycodone through two gyms in south Snohomish County, according to Sgt. John Flood of the task force.

    Some of those distributing the drugs were personal trainers in Snohomish and King County gyms and fitness centers, according to a news release from the U.S. Attorney's Office in Seattle. It was unclear yesterday whether Witter works as a personal trainer. Family members present at a court hearing yesterday declined to answer questions.

    Flood said the investigation began with a tip to law enforcement from a confidential informant. Investigators responded by sending uncover officers to the gyms where they posed as members "looking to get hooked up with anabolic steroids ." Flood declined to identify the gyms, but said that they were cooperating with law enforcement.

    A federal indictment also accuses Witter of laundering money involved with the purchase of the drugs by illegally transferring at least $100,000 to Mexico. Investigators say the drugs were imported to the United States from Tijuana, Mexico, and distributed mainly "in Snohomish County, but also as far south as Portland and as far east as Moses Lake."

    U.S. Magistrate Judge Monica Benton ordered Witter held pending a detention hearing on Monday. If found guilty, he faces up to 20 years in prison on each of the two charges.

    The indictment also charges Edward John Suden, 45, of Edmonds with conspiracy to distribute controlled substances. He was arrested yesterday afternoon and is scheduled to appear in court this morning.
